Dade County Sheriff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Dade County Sheriff in the United States is $77,834.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$37. Salaries at Dade County Sheriff typically range from $68,058 to $89,052 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Atlanta?

Understanding the cost of living near Atlanta is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Dade County Sheriff.
Atlanta's Cost of Living Index is approximately 105.0 (5.0% more expensive than US average; 12.9% more than GA average). Major SE hub, housing costs above US avg, especially in desirable neighborhoods. MARTA rail/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Dade County Sheriff,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,500 - $2,300+ A significant portion of Dade County Sheriff sal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$95 (MART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,945 - $4,625+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
